ADAS Recalibration Services

Capital Auto Glass now offers Advanced Driver Assistance System (ADAS) recalibration services. Modern vehicles equipped with ADAS technology have been shown to reduce head-on crashes by up to 50% — but only when these systems are properly calibrated.

After a windshield replacement, any cameras or sensors mounted to or near the windshield must be recalibrated to manufacturer specifications. Skipping this step can cause lane departure alerts, automatic braking, and other safety features to malfunction.

ADAS Systems We Recalibrate

Lane Departure Warning (LDWS)

Alerts you when your vehicle drifts from its lane without signaling.

Lane Keep Assist (LKA)

Actively prevents unintended lane departure by gently steering back into the lane.

Adaptive Cruise Control (ACC)

Maintains a safe following distance from vehicles ahead automatically.

Forward Collision Alert (FCA)

Detects the distance to vehicles in front and alerts when a collision is imminent.

Blind Spot Monitoring (BSM)

Alerts you to vehicles in your blind spots when changing lanes.

Traffic Sign Recognition (TSR)

Identifies and displays road signs including speed limits.

Pedestrian Detection (PD)

Warns of pedestrians and cyclists in or near the vehicle’s path.

Calibration Methods

Static Calibration

Performed in our facility with the vehicle parked. Uses laser equipment and specialized tools to achieve precise manufacturer-standard alignment.

Dynamic Calibration

Performed on the road at specific speeds using portable diagnostic devices connected to the vehicle’s OBD II port.

Dual Calibration

Combines both static and dynamic methods at our facility — required by some vehicle manufacturers for complete recalibration.
